Shawn Murphy was born December 17, 1982, and he is a former American football guard who was drafted by the Miami Dolphins in the fourth round of the 2008 NFL Draft.
Murphy has also been a member of the Tampa Bay Buccaneers, Carolina Panthers, and Denver Broncos. He is the son of former Major League Baseball player Dale Murphy
Murphy has a height of 1.93m and weighs 134kg
in 2007, Murphy led all WAC offensive linemen with 137 knockdown blocks while also only allowing one quarterback sack. He earned one of the top consistency grades of any player at his position in the collegiate ranks. As a result, he received an All-American honorable mention and All-WAC second-team recognition.

Did Shawn Murphy play College football?
Of course, he did! He played one year of college football at Ricks College before going on a two-year Mormon mission in Brazil; upon his return, he attended Dixie State College of Utah before finishing at Utah State, where he earned academic all-conference honors.
